OVERALL PURPOSE OF THE POST:

The Service Coordinator will be responsible for leading a dedicated
team in delivering quality standards of care and support to children
with physical and sensory support needs, ID and Autism in a person
centered service. This will involve working with and being supported
by management in obtaining (where required) and maintaining
registration with the Health Information and Quality Authority. The
Post holder will work with the PIC to direct services including the
assessment, planning, delivery, evaluation of care to children and in
providing support on person centred positive behavioural approaches to
staff on the needs of individuals with complex behaviours of concern

The post is Monday-Friday with some flexibility required

THE SUCCESSFUL CANDIDATE WILL HAVE:

_ESSENTIAL CRITERIA:_

* Have a third level qualification in Nursing/ Social Care/ Education
or relevant field
* Min 3 years post qualification experience working with people with
Disabilities in a residential setting
* Evidence of at least 1 year of management/staff supervisory
experience
* Experience working with children who present with behaviours of
concern
* Full clean drivers licence and have access to own transport

_DESIRABLE CRITERIA:_

* Management course commenced or completed
* Experience in delivering training
